小乐乐喜欢数字,尤其喜欢0和1,他现在得到了一个数,想把每位的数变成0或1。如果某一位是奇数,就把它变成1,如果是偶数,那么就把它安成0。请你回答他最后得到的数是多少。
输出描述:
输出一个整数,即小乐乐修改后得到的数字。
示例1
输入:222222
输出:0
示例2
输入:123
输出:101
#include<stdio.h>
#include<math.h>
int main()
{
int input, sum = 0;
scanf("%d", &input);
int i=0,flag=0;
while (input)
{
int bit = input % 10;
if (bit % 2 == 1)
{
flag = 1;
}
else
{
flag = 0;
}
sum += flag * pow(10, i);
input/=10;
i++;
}
printf("%d", sum);
return 0;
}